Video: Bolehkah kita menggunakan pernyataan yang disediakan untuk pertanyaan pilihan dalam Java?
2024 Pengarang: Lynn Donovan | [email protected]. Diubah suai terakhir: 2023-12-15 23:51
Cara menggunakan pernyataan yang disediakan untuk pertanyaan pilihan dalam Java dengan MySQL? Sekarang awak boleh paparkan semua rekod jadual menggunakan Java PreparedStatement . awak perlu guna kaedah executeQuery().
Jadi, apa gunanya kenyataan yang disediakan?
A kenyataan yang disediakan ialah ciri yang digunakan untuk melaksanakan SQL yang sama (atau serupa). kenyataan berulang kali dengan kecekapan yang tinggi. Kenyataan yang disediakan pada dasarnya berfungsi seperti ini: Sediakan : Sebuah SQL kenyataan templat dibuat dan dihantar ke pangkalan data. Nilai tertentu dibiarkan tidak ditentukan, dipanggil parameter (berlabel "?").
Begitu juga, bolehkah kita menggunakan pernyataan yang disediakan tunggal untuk berbilang pertanyaan? 5 Jawapan. ya awak boleh semula guna a Kenyataan (khususnya a PreparedStatement ) dan sepatutnya buat jadi secara umum dengan JDBC. Ia akan menjadi gaya yang tidak cekap & buruk jika awak tidak semula guna awak kenyataan dan segera mencipta satu lagi yang serupa Kenyataan objek.
Ringkasnya, apakah kegunaan penyediaan pernyataan di Jawa?
PreparedStatement dalam Java membolehkan anda menulis pertanyaan berparameter yang memberikan prestasi yang lebih baik daripada Kenyataan kelas masuk Jawa . 2. Dalam kes PreparedStatement , Pangkalan data guna pelan akses yang telah disusun dan ditentukan, ini membolehkan kenyataan yang disediakan pertanyaan untuk berjalan lebih cepat daripada pertanyaan biasa.
Bagaimanakah anda menggunakan semula pernyataan yang disediakan?
Menggunakan semula a PreparedStatement Sekali a PreparedStatement ialah disediakan , ia boleh digunakan semula selepas pelaksanaan. awak guna semula a PreparedStatement dengan menetapkan nilai baharu untuk parameter dan kemudian laksanakannya semula. Berikut ialah contoh mudah: String sql = kemas kini orang set firstname=?, lastname=?
Disyorkan:
Bolehkah kita menggunakan continue dalam pernyataan suis?
Pernyataan continue hanya digunakan pada gelung, bukan pada pernyataan suis. A terus di dalam suis di dalam gelung menyebabkan lelaran gelung seterusnya. Sudah tentu anda perlu melampirkan gelung (semasa, untuk, buat sementara) untuk terus bekerja
Bolehkah kita menggunakan pernyataan continue dalam suis dalam C?
Ya, tidak mengapa - ia sama seperti menggunakannya dalam ifstatement. Sudah tentu, anda tidak boleh menggunakan rehat untuk keluar dari gelung dari dalam suis. Ya, continueakan diabaikan oleh pernyataan suis dan akan pergi ke keadaan gelung untuk diuji
Bolehkah kita menggunakan laksana segera untuk pernyataan pilihan?
Program ini boleh menggunakan EXECUTE IMMEDIATE. EXECUTE IMMEDIATE mentakrifkan gelung pilih untuk memproses baris yang dikembalikan. Jika pilihan mengembalikan hanya satu baris, tidak perlu menggunakan gelung pilih
Apakah kegunaan pernyataan yang disediakan dalam MySQL?
Pangkalan data MySQL menyokong pernyataan yang disediakan. Kenyataan yang disediakan atau pernyataan berparameter digunakan untuk melaksanakan pernyataan yang sama berulang kali dengan kecekapan tinggi. Pelaksanaan pernyataan yang disediakan terdiri daripada dua peringkat: menyediakan dan melaksanakan
Bolehkah kita menggunakan pernyataan DDL dalam prosedur dalam Oracle?
Penyataan DDL tidak dibenarkan dalam Prosedur (PLSQL BLOCK) objek PL/SQL diprakompil. Sebaliknya, pernyataan DDL (Bahasa Definisi Data) seperti arahan CREATE, DROP, ALTER dan DCL (Bahasa Kawalan Data) seperti GRANT, REVOKE boleh menukar kebergantungan semasa pelaksanaan program